Fall 2019 – a new season full of promise

By Wendy Steger, Pastor Learn (2019)

Fall is in the air. The evenings have become cool and crisp, and the State Fair has come and gone. Warm memories of summer fun linger in our minds, as we collectively get ready for a new season. Fall can be experienced as a time of endings, but it is also an exciting time of new beginnings. The backpacks are full with new school supplies. Class lists have been posted, and new friendships will be made. Even adults find “routine” again, even if that routine is different than the year before. As one season comes to a close, a new season awaits full of promise.

With this new season, comes many opportunities to help you grow in faith.

Starting with our youngest, we have a new event for families with children from infants to age three. We offer Sunday school (GodZone) for preschool through third grade. On Wednesday evenings, we have weekly classes for Zone 45 (4th and 5th graders) and Confirmation (6th through 9th grade). New high school small groups will also begin this fall.

We also have a number of opportunities for adults, including a new Parent Connect group. There are Bible studies, book studies, and classes that range from one day to two years. Will you challenge your routine, and include something new that supports your faith this fall?

And all are invited to our annual Block Party on September 7, as we celebrate God’s goodness and the promise of new beginnings.

We hope you will join us this fall as together we launch into a new season of ministry. God is always at work among us, making us new and refreshing us for a life of loving God and loving others. In Isaiah 43:19, God says, “I am about to do a new thing; now it springs forth, do you not perceive it? I will make a way in the wilderness and rivers in the desert.”

God is at work, making all things new. As summer gives way to fall, let us celebrate the work God does among us.
